Features and Functionality of Grass Cutter Robots
Grass cutter robots are equipped with a range of features that make them highly efficient and user-friendly. One of the key components is their ability to navigate and map out the area they are tasked with mowing. Using a combination of GPS technology and onboard sensors, these robots can create a virtual map of the lawn, ensuring they cover every inch without missing any spots.
These devices are designed to handle various lawn sizes and terrains. Whether it’s a small backyard or a sprawling estate, grass cutter robots can be programmed to suit the specific needs of the area. They come with adjustable cutting heights, allowing users to customize the length of their grass according to their preferences. Additionally, many models are equipped with rain sensors, which ensure that the robot returns to its charging station during adverse weather conditions, preventing any potential damage.
Another standout feature is the ability to schedule mowing sessions. Users can set specific times for the robot to operate, ensuring the lawn is always maintained without any manual intervention. This scheduling capability is particularly useful for busy individuals who want to ensure their lawns remain pristine without having to remember to start the mower manually.

Comparing Grass Cutter Robots to Traditional Lawn Mowers
When comparing grass cutter robots to traditional lawn mowers, several differences become apparent, each with its own set of advantages and considerations. Traditional mowers have been the go-to option for decades, but robotic mowers are quickly gaining popularity due to their innovative approach to lawn care.
One of the most significant differences is the level of automation. Traditional mowers require manual operation, which can be time-consuming and physically demanding, especially for larger lawns. In contrast, grass cutter robots operate autonomously, reducing the need for human intervention and allowing users to focus on other tasks.
Environmental impact is another area where robotic mowers have an edge. They run on rechargeable batteries, eliminating the need for gasoline and reducing emissions. This eco-friendly approach aligns with the growing trend towards sustainable living. Additionally, robotic mowers tend to be quieter than their traditional counterparts, minimizing noise pollution and making them suitable for residential areas.
However, traditional mowers may still hold an advantage in terms of power and speed for certain tasks, such as cutting through thick or overgrown grass. They also tend to be less expensive upfront, although the long-term savings on fuel and maintenance for robotic mowers can offset this initial cost.
